As Nigeria commemorates Democracy Day, Hon. Kazim Adeyinka Adeniyi Bibire, former Special Adviser to Oyo State Governor, Seyi Makinde on Local Government and Chieftaincy Matters, has issued a powerful message of hope, reflection, and renewed purpose, calling on Nigerian youth to take charge of their democratic future.

 

 

 

Hon. Kazim Adeyinka Adeniyi Bibire, who is widely regarded as a grassroots mobilizer and a key political figure in Ibadan North, used the occasion to salute the sacrifices of pro-democracy heroes, particularly Chief MKO Abiola, whose annulled 1993 mandate remains a defining moment in Nigeria’s democratic history.

 

 

 

“June 12 is not just a date—it is a symbol of struggle, sacrifice, and the unbroken will of the Nigerian people to choose their own path.

 

 

 

We owe it to the memory of our heroes to uphold the spirit of democracy in our everyday governance and interactions,” Bibire stated.

 

 

 

As a Federal House of Representatives aspirant for Ibadan North, Bibire emphasized that the nation’s future rests on deepening civic education, fostering youth inclusion in politics, and strengthening institutions at both local and national levels.

“Nigeria’s democracy is only as strong as the participation of its people.

 

 

I call on our youths, especially those in Ibadan North, to rise beyond the sidelines and become active builders of the Nigeria they want to see.

 

 

The time to stop outsourcing leadership is now,” he said.

 

 

 

Bibire praised the efforts of successive administrations in preserving democratic gains, particularly the decision of former President Muhammadu Buhari to officially recognize June 12 as Democracy Day, a move he described as “a bold correction of history.”

 

 

 

He also commended the current administration and Governor Seyi Makinde for maintaining peaceful democratic processes in Oyo State, and for providing platforms that empower the people at the grassroots.

 

 

 

In a message filled with both optimism and realism, Hon. Kazim Adeyinka Bibire urged Nigerians not to give in to despair, despite

economic and political challenges.

 

 

 

“Democracy is a journey, sometimes slow, sometimes tough.

 

 

But it is our best path toward justice, equity, and a truly representative government.

 

 

Let us not relent in our push for reforms, fairness, and opportunities for all,” he added.

 

 

 

Hon. Kazim Adeyinka Bibire concluded his message with a passionate call to action:

 

 

 

“On this June 12, I stand with the people of Ibadan North and all Nigerians in saying: our voices matter, our votes matter, and our future is worth fighting for. Let us keep hope alive.”
